Sabrina Carpenter Looks So Different With a Long Bob — See Photo


While everyone I know is listening to Sabrina Carpenter‘s new album, Man’s Best Friend, I’m over here having a staring contest with her new Vogue Italia cover. And can you blame me? The inherently stunning pop star is looking out unblinkingly from the warm, retro Steven Meisel portrait, wearing Pat McGrath-applied eye makeup that’s just begging me to fail to recreate it. But perhaps the most mesmerizing element of the look is her updated ‘do.

Even when she switches things up and away from her signature look, Carpenter tends to exude blonde bombshell energy, and her Vogue Italia shoot is no exception. But instead of her usual length—typically anywhere from mid-shoulder-blade to way down to her waist—the singer-songwriter is seen in a downright inspirational lob styled by Guido Palau.

Shoulder-length hair can often feel like a temporary layover while growing out a short style into a longer one or making a safe chop on the way to a shorter look, but this full, flippy, voluminous take on the long bob is far from “neither here nor there.” Palau has given Carpenter a blowout that combines ‘90s and ’60s vibes to create a modern take on polished oomph that proves glamour doesn’t depend on lengthening extensions.
